About this webinar

Join Alice Searle, Caroline Bicheno and Kim Wilson, three neurological physiotherapists and facilitators for this session exploring top tips for managing a neurological physio case study. The session will include:

  • Revision of neuroanatomy and physiology of a stroke and how this may impact on a person's living
  • Revision of subjective and objective assessment of a person who has had a stroke and lives in a community setting
  • Discussion of neurophysiotherapy treatment options for this person
  • Discussion of roles of the wider MDT with this person

Ahead of the webinar, you may find some pre-reading beneficial - our speakers have recommended the National Clinical Guidelines for Stroke, 2023: https://www.strokeguideline.org

We hope this session will give you an opportunity to get practical tips on managing neurological physio interview questions ahead of your first role.

About our speakers

Alice Searle is a Clinical Specialist in Neurological Physiotherapy. Founder of Surrey Neuro Physio, working in the community with people with varying neurological deficits.

Caroline Bicheno is a Specialist Neurological Physiotherapist. Works self employed in the community with 25 years of experience treating patients with neurological deficits.

Kim Wilson is a Specialist Neurological Physiotherapist. Founder of Surrey Hills Rehab that provides a neurorehabilitation service for people in her local community of Cranleigh, Surrey.

About the webinar series

This webinar series, run by the CSP South East Coast regional network, is offering graduates and final year students some support with your transition into the workplace. We know it can be a challenge to get that first role, and the region is keen to support you in developing your interview skills.

This is also suitable for you if you are a final year student wishing to get yourself ready for future interviews.

This webinar series is open to graduates and final year students across the country. We want to help you where we can and support you in what should be an exciting time!

Don't worry, this isn't about any tests or exposing lack of knowledge, these webinars are a chance to hear first-hand advice and experiences on developing your interview skills from physios and experts who want to see our grad physios flourish in the professional world.

The series plans to offer sessions covering a range of specialisms, including MSK specific, Cardio-resp specific, Neuro specific and Frailty specific to name a few... Network members from both the NHS and Private sector are giving their time and experience to share with you thoughts on how to stand out at interview.
